What Is the Staff-to-Dog Ratio?
A good staff-to-dog ratio is vital for ensuring your pet gets adequate attention and care during their boarding keep.
Ideally, you want to see a reduced ratio, which indicates that each employee can concentrate on a smaller number of pet dogs. This enables more customized interactions and immediate actions to your pet dog's demands.
When looking into boarding centers, inquire about their staff-to-dog ratio during peak times and just how it transforms throughout the day. A ratio of 1:5 or much better is typically suggested for risk-free and mindful treatment.
Don't be reluctant to inquire about personnel training and experience, as well. Understanding that your canine will remain in capable hands can give you peace of mind while you're away.
Are Vaccination Records Required?
Prior to boarding your pet dog, you need to confirm whether the facility calls for vaccination documents. Numerous reputable boarding facilities mandate evidence of vaccinations to guarantee the safety and security and health of all dogs in their care.
Typical inoculations include rabies, distemper, and bordetella, which secure versus contagious conditions that can spread out rapidly in group setups. When you offer these documents, you're aiding preserve a safe environment for your dog and others.
If a facility does not need inoculations, it might indicate a lack of appropriate health procedures. Do not hesitate to ask the center concerning their inoculation plans and what specific records they need.
This information can provide you comfort, understanding your canine will certainly be in a healthy and balanced setting during their keep.

How Is Feeding Handled?
After guaranteeing your canine will certainly get lots of workout and socializing, it is essential to clarify exactly how feeding is managed at the boarding facility.
Inquire about their feeding schedule and if they suit unique diet plans or preferences your pet might have. You'll need to know if you can give your pet's own food to preserve consistency and stay clear of digestive system problems.
Ask about section sizes and exactly how typically your pet dog will be fed each day. It's also important to discover if they offer deals with and snacks, as this can influence your pet dog's convenience and happiness during their stay.
Finally, validate that'll be responsible for feeding and if they'll monitor your dog's consuming behaviors.
What Is the Plan for Emergency Situations or Health problem?
What occurs if your pet dog gets ill or has an emergency situation while boarding? This is a crucial question to ask prior to scheduling. You wish to know the center's procedure for taking care of emergencies.
Do they've a vet on-call, or will they take your pet to a neighboring facility? It's likewise essential to comprehend if they'll call you promptly in situation of illness or injury.
Inquire about their plan on administering medicines and exactly how they deal with persistent problems. Additionally, clarify whether they need you to sign a waiver concerning possible dangers.
Recognizing these information can offer you peace of mind while you're away, guaranteeing your furry good friend gets the treatment they require in a difficult circumstance.
